“…Notably, during the observation at T m ( Z ) – 50 °C and T m ( Z ) – 60 °C under UV irradiation, when the crystal bent to a certain degree, a part of the crystal hopped away from the original position, thus exhibiting a photosalient effect (Figure S25 and Video S3). Similar photomechanical behaviors were reported for acylhydrazide derivatives by some research groups, who suggested a mechanism based on the E -to- Z isomerization. The present NC cases provide valuable contributions to these behaviors because the crystal structures of both isomers are available.…”

“…For example, Aprahamian et al. achieved control of their thermal half-lives in the range of days to thousands of years and high conversion yield over 90%. , Similar high photoswitching performances have been observed for acylhydrazones. , Notably, acylhydrazones are often distinguished from hydrazones due to their molecular structures being less restricted between the E -form and Z -form. , Furthermore, acylhydrazones exhibit photoisomerization even in a solid state and thereby are promising candidates for PCLT-active crystals. However, to the best of our knowledge, there have been no reported examples of such applications of acylhydrazones.…”
